Q: Is 324,453,326 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 324,453,326 is a composite number.

Why is 324,453,326 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 324,453,326 can be evenly divided by 1 2 10,289 15,767 20,578 31,534 162,226,663 and 324,453,326, with no remainder.

Since 324,453,326 cannot be divided by just 1 and 324,453,326, it is a composite number.
